You can clean out totally the entire head oilways, with the head in situ, a bit cramped to do but no bigee.
The heads oil gallerys run on the outside/side of the head each side, and are plugged at each end, the oil drain back is easy to block with paper towel etc, and use a drill(in your hand) to check each oilway is clear, can take the plugs out each end and pull through with proper lace brushes to make sure everything is 100% spotless.
